Lower Gar State Recreation Area is a great place for a family picnic. There are several picnic tables located throughout this nicely
shaded area with a great view of Lower Gar Lake.

Lower Gar is one of the five lakes connected in the Iowa Great Lakes chain along with West Okoboji, East Okoboji, Minnewashta, and
Upper Gar. Lower Gar State Recreation Area also offers the user a boat ramp to launch a boat, and several areas to fish along the
shoreline.
West Okoboji and the many other lakes of the area are some of the prime fishing spots in Iowa. Anglers will find challenging
sport pursuing a variety of game fish, including walleye, northern pike, smallmouth bass, white bass, perch, bluegills, crappies,
catfish, and bullheads. Boating is also very popular on the lakes using everything from canoes to sailboats and ski rigs.
The "lakes area" of northwest Iowa offers a tremendous array of outdoor recreation opportunities, year-round. The
unique setting of beautiful and clear Lakes East and West Okoboji, Big Spirit Lake and other water bodies truly provides wonderful
opportunities for outdoor recreation. The focal point for state parks and recreation areas in this region is beautiful Gull Point
State Park, established in 1933. Gull Point provides a pleasing, shaded setting on West Okoboji Lake and offers a well-rounded
variety of outdoor recreation facilities.
Lower Gar State Recreation Area is located in the Iowa Great Lakes region near the towns of Milford, Arnolds Park, Okoboji,
and Spirit Lake.
